Hannah Peach 1646–1687 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1646

Birth Location: Marblehead, Essex, Massachusetts, USA

Death Date: 10 Jan. 1687

Death Location: Massachusetts, United States

Father: John II

Mother: Alice Peach

Spouse(s): William Waters

Children(s): William Waters

The story of Hannah Peach began in 1646 in Marblehead, Essex, Massachusetts, USA. Hannah Peach married William Waters, and had children including William Waters. Hannah Peach passed away in 1687 in Massachusetts, United States.
